Mission: Unbridled Thoroughbred Foundation protects horses from exploitation and slaughter. Through advocacy, care, and education, Unbridled aims to amass appreciation for the inherent worth of Thoroughbreds. Through active learning, we foster recognition of the agency, autonomy, individuality, intelligence, and emotional depth unique to each horse to expand understanding of who horses are and how they experience their lives. In all that we do, it is our purpose to embolden a new ethical perspective to deepen the horse-human bond, and to inspire kindness towards Thoroughbreds as friends who are valued as fellow sentient beings.

Results: Since 2004, Unbridled has saved the lives of hundreds of Thoroughbreds who otherwise would have been slaughtered. We rehabilitate, retrain, and rehome rescued Thoroughbreds through adoption, and sustain a teaching herd of senior Thoroughbreds in Sanctuary. Our advocacy, media campaigns, and educational programs have raised awareness of the exploitation of Thoroughbreds, inspired community action, and resulted in new industry measures and legislative initiatives to protect Thoroughbreds. Our literacy programs have served hundreds of community members and earned an official partnership with the NYS Libraries Summer Reading Program.
